CHICAGO (AP) - Governor Pat Quinn has signed legislation that pays off more than $1 billion of Illinois' overdue bills. Quinn yesterday signed legislation that pays down the bill backlog of a number of social service providers. Among the bills being paid off, the Community Care Program will receive $142 million, group health insurance will get $350 million and $500 million will go to Medicaid bills.
